Jul 2, 2009 -- 1:06PM, woody2goody wrote:

The problem with Shelton, and why he doesn't get enough heat, is the fact that he loses too often.  His last couple of feuds were booked badly.  His matches with Taker, which were really good, should have been built upon in his battles with R-Truth and John Morrison, but in the end he only one one or two matches out of about 6 or 7 against those two.  I don't think he actually beat JoMo at all. 

People hated it when Kozlov beat Undertaker, and Matt Hardy, and others, and that's why Kozlov is good.  He wins.  And people don't like it.  Same with heel Triple H.

If Shelton is booked as a threat, people will accept it.  like before Wrestlemania, when he had a mini-feud with Taker, it looked like it was going to lead to him having a great Royal Rumble, and possibly a money in the bank win, but then the bookers didn't do anything with him.

If Shelton went on an arrogant, cocky winning streak for a few weeks over fan favourites, he would get a lot of heat.  This week, and last week on Smackdown proved he is charismatic, articulate and intelligent, and let's face it - this week was a feud starting match with Yoshi.

It's all set for those two to have a good feud with excellent matches.
